Léon Elchinger (1871-1942): glazed terracotta vase with 4 handles. Léon Elchinger, born on December 3, 1871 in Soufflenheim in the German Empire and died on February 8, 1942 in Soufflenheim, Bas-Rhin, is a French ceramist and politician of German origin who is part of the circle of Saint-Léonard.
